Series 803 ASAP Cordsets For Harsh Environments
A
Glenair’s ASAP “Mighty Mouse”
Overmolded Cordsets
offer
splashproof protection and excellent
cold temperature flexibility. These
cables are 100% tested and ready
to use.Standard overmolded
cables feature polyurethane
jackets.
Two Jacket Types
– Extruded
Estane polyurethane jacket
resists abrasion and chemicals. Or
choose low smoke/ zero halogen
polyurethane jackets for compliance
with toxicity regulations.
Shielded
– These cables feature
90% coverage tinned copper braid.
Cable shields terminate directly
to connectors with stainless steel
BAND-IT®
straps.
Simplified Ordering, No Minimums
ASAP
cordsets are made-to-order
from stocked connectors and cable.
Choose #22 or #24 AWG cable with
standard Estane jacket for best
availability.
